Ukrainian strikes hit power, heating of 2 cities in Russia

Ukrainian strikes disrupted power and heating to two major Russian cities near the Ukrainian border, local Russian officials reported on Sunday.

The report comes as Russia and Ukraine have traded almost daily assaults on each other’s energy infrastructure and US-led diplomatic efforts to stop the nearly four-year war have not advanced.

Elsewhere, Ukraine's top diplomat accused Moscow of deliberately endangering nuclear safety, as he said Russia’s mass drone and missile attack on Friday struck substations that power two nuclear power plants.

And in Russia, the Kremlin spokesman said Moscow intended to honour its obligations under a global nuclear test ban, despite a recent order by President Vladimir Putin to study the possibility of resuming atomic tests.

A drone strike temporarily caused blackouts and cut heating to parts of Voronezh, regional Governor Alexander Gusev said.

He said several drones were electronically jammed during the night over the city, home to just over 1 million people, sparking a fire at a local utility facility that was quickly extinguished.

Russian and Ukrainian news channels on Telegram claimed the strike targeted a local thermal power plant.

A missile strike late on Saturday also caused “serious damage” to power and heating systems supplying the city of Belgorod, with some 20,000 households affected, local Governor Vyacheslav Gladkov reported the following morning.
